Steven Gerrard gives Liverpool theory on Premier League struggles amid Arne Slot sack pressureLiverpool lost to Brighton in the Premier League as their domestic football struggles continue in Arne Slot's second season and former captain Steven Gerrard has had his sayView 2 Images Steven Gerrard has a theory on Liverpool's struggles (Image: TNT Sports)Liverpool icon Steven Gerrard believes Arne Slot currently lacks the depth to compete in both the Champions League and the Premier League following the Reds' defeat to Brighton. The Reds currently sit in fifth in the division, in a battle for qualification for the Champions League, having lost ten matches in a season for the first time in a decade. Brighton star Danny Welbeck scored a goal either side of Milos Kerkez's strike, with the Liverpool defender nipping in to capitalise on Lewis Dunk's error. "We have seen it quite a few times this season now where they put a lot of effort, perform really well on the Champions League stage," Gerrard offered on TNT Sports. For his part, Slot accepts that he is under pressure, despite guiding Liverpool to a league title last season.
